So yesterday, I upgraded Office 2000 to Office XP Pro. Afterwards, I attempted to use Activesync and the only items that synched were Files, Inbox, and Favorites. Wondering what happened to
Calendar, Contacts, Notes, Tasks, I clicked on Options and noticed that the checkboxes to activate the synchronization of these items were all
gone! I don't mean disabled--they're just not there anymore.
I searched for more info and attempted the following:
- Soft Reset
- Disabled ZoneAlarm
- Deleted partnership
- Detect & Repair Outlook
- Ran scanpst.exe on my PST file
- Reinstalled ActiveSync 3.8
- Uninstalled AS 3.8 and Installed 4.2
Everything to no avail...
I'm pretty sure the problem is a corrupt file on the PDA because using Activesync on my computer with the Axim off the cradle and the partnership deleted, I could see my contacts and such through the AS options dialogue. So what are my options now?
I'm trying to avoid a hard reset because the last time I backed up with AS was after this happened (whoops). Is there a way to reinstall Pocket Outlook? I'm also using Pocket Informant. Would reinstalling that help? I think I should also roll back to AS 3.8. How do I do that? Please help!
